"Higher Structures in M-Theory"
Dear Colleagues, We are delighted to announce the EPSRC/LMS Durham Symposium on "Higher Structures in M-Theory" to take place 12-18 August 2018 at Durham University, United Kingdom. http://www.maths.dur.ac.uk/lms/109/ Recent years have seen significant advances in the development of higher (categorified) mathematical structures, and there are first and very encouraging examples of applications of these within string and M-theory. The intention of this symposium is to bring together experts working on mathematical aspects of M-theory and experts studying physical implications of M-theory. Key topics that will be covered include: - Higher Differential Geometry and Higher Lie Theory - Higher Gauge Theory - Higher Structures in M- and F-Theory - Double and Exceptional Field Theory and Duality Symmetric String and M-Theory - Higher (Pre)Quantisation - Higher Spin Theory There is a conference fee of £40.
